"Exsurgo is a medical equipment manufacturer that used neuroscience and data analytics to develop treatments for neurological conditions."
Founded in New Zealand around 2015, Exsurgo produces noninvasive hardware and end-user software.
Exsurgo makes tools for medical diagnosis and treatment through body/mind state interpretation and/or neurostimulation therapies and the assisted control of mechanical,electrical,and digital devices/applications.
BCI Categories: Open-Loop Efferent, Closed-Loop Efferent
Neurosensing Technique(s): EEG
